Lizard utthan pristhasana in sanskrit is an intermediate hip openers and standing yoga pose lizard.

Lizard Pose In Sanskrit. It stretches the back of the body along with the hips hence named so. From downward facing dog the yogi steps one foot forward and outside of the hand before lowering the forearms to the floor. In this Utthan stands for stretch out and the meaning of Pristha is the page of a book or Back of the body and Asana represents seat pose or posture.

Step 3 Step your right foot outside of your right hand. Since the pose focuses on the hips most men usually struggle with the posture. It is also popularly known by its English names lizard pose or gecko pose.

Lizard pose or utthan pristhasana in Sanskrit is a deep hip opener that prepares the body for more advanced postures. Lizard Pose or Utthan Pristhasana in Sanskrit comes from the words Utthan meaning stretching out and Pristha meaning back of the body An alternate translation of Pristha is page of a book an appropriate description as we hold many of our emotions in our hips. Utthan Pristhasana OOT-ahn preesth-AHS-ah-nah is a deep lunge that strengthens the groin and inner hamstrings while preparing the body for deeper hip openers. Opening your hips may help you alleviate low back pain and will increase your hip-joint mobility.
